数据传输方法及装置制造方法及图纸

技术编号:15706385 阅读:220 留言:0更新日期:2017-06-26 19:24
一种数据传输方法,所述方法包括:确定传输块TB循环冗余校验CRC的添加方式;根据所确定的传输块循环冗余校验的添加方式确定传输块循环冗余校验的长度;基于所述传输块循环冗余校验的长度,计算传输块循环冗余校验比特,并将所述传输块循环冗余校验比特作为传输块的一部分;对包含所述传输块循环冗余校验比特的传输块进行处理,并将处理后的数据发送给接收设备。本发明专利技术还提供一种数据传输装置。本发明专利技术能提升传输效率,降低传输块的虚警率,提高系统的鲁棒性。

Data transmission method and device

A data transmission method, the method includes determining adding mode of transmission block TB cyclic redundancy check CRC; transmission block cyclic redundancy check length is determined according to the adding mode of transmission block cyclic redundancy check is determined; based on the transmission block cyclic redundancy check the length of the calculation of the transmission block cyclic redundancy check bit. And the transmission block cyclic redundancy check bit as part of a transmission block; processing the transmission block comprising the transmission block cyclic redundancy check bits, and sends the processed data to the receiving device. The invention also provides a data transmission device. The invention can improve the transmission efficiency, reduce the false alarm rate of the transmission block, and improve the robustness of the system.

【技术实现步骤摘要】
数据传输方法及装置
本专利技术涉及通讯
,尤其涉及一种数据传输方法及装置。
技术介绍
在3GPP长期演进(LongTermEvolution,LTE)编码方案中,对来自逻辑信道的传输块(transportblock,TB)经过传输块循环冗余校验(CyclicRedundancyCheck,CRC)添加、码块分段、码块(codeblock,CB)循环冗余校验添加、信道编码、速率匹配、码块级联等一系列的比特操作,发送给后续处理模块。在接收机侧,完成相应的逆操作,也就是,解码块级联、解速率匹配、信道译码、校验码块循环冗余校验、去除码块循环冗余校验、传输块循环冗余校验等操作,解调得到传输块的数据信息,并发送给逻辑信道。假定传输块长度为A,则添加传输块循环冗余校验后的传输块长度B=A+L;每个传输块包含了长度为L的校验比特,用于接收机侧校验该传输块是否正确解调。LTE系统中,传输块循环冗余校验的长度是固定的,等于24比特。传输块循环冗余校验的长度,就决定了该传输块的虚警概率。通常来说,传输块循环冗余校验的虚警概率FA=2-L,L表示传输块循环冗余校验的长度,L数值越大,则传输块的虚警概率越低,虚警带来的错误重传损失越小,系统的传输效率越高。随着人们对无线通信需求的增强,现在第五代移动通信技术(5th-Generation,5G)新空口接入技术(NewRadioAccessTechnology,NR)正在如火如荼地研究中,NR中的增强移动宽带(enhancedmobilebroadband,eMBB)场景是指在现有移动宽带业务场景的基础上,对于用户体验等性能进一步的提升,主要还是追求人与人之间极致的通信体验。eMBB场景主要面向局部热点区域,为用户提供极高的数据传输速率,满足网络极高的流量密度需求。相比于LTE,eMBB场景的传输块长度会大大增加。这种情况下,若出现传输块循环冗余校验的虚检测,物理层错误地将一个非正确接收的传输块发送给了媒体访问控制MediaAccessControl(MAC)层,这样将带来媒体访问控制层的自动重复请求(AutomaticRepeatRequest,ARQ)重传,引起很大的资源浪费。通常来说,传输块循环冗余校验的虚警概率FA=2-L,L表示传输块循环冗余校验的长度,L数值越大,则传输块的虚警概率越低,虚警带来的错误重传损失越小。对于L=24,虚警概率大概是6e-8,相比于eMBB场景下混合自动重传请求(HybridAutomaticRepeatreQuest,HARQ)+ARQ机制下要求的1e-6到1e-9左右的误帧率,并不算很低,需要进一步提升。
技术实现思路
鉴于以上内容,有必要提供一种数据传输方法及装置,能提升传输效率,降低传输块的虚警率,提高系统的鲁棒性。一种数据传输方法,应用于发送设备,所述方法包括:确定传输块TB循环冗余校验CRC的添加方式;根据所确定的传输块循环冗余校验的添加方式确定传输块循环冗余校验的长度;基于所述传输块循环冗余校验的长度,计算传输块循环冗余校验比特,并将所述传输块循环冗余校验比特作为传输块的一部分;对包含所述传输块循环冗余校验比特的传输块进行处理,并将处理后的数据发送给接收设备。根据本专利技术优选实施例,所述确定传输块循环冗余校验的添加方式包括:通过静态的方式,获取预先定义的传输块循环冗余校验的添加方式;或根据通信调度策略从预设配置的第一数据库中确定传输块的循环冗余校验的添加方式;或接收所述接收设备发送的所选择的传输块循环冗余校验的添加方式,并根据所述接收设备所选择的传输块循环冗余校验的添加方式,从预先配置的第一数据库中确定传输块循环冗余校验的添加方式,所述第一数据库包含至少一种传输块循环冗余校验的添加方式。根据本专利技术优选实施例,在根据通信调度策略从预设配置的第一数据库中确定传输块的循环冗余校验的添加方式之后,或在根据所述接收设备所选择的传输块循环冗余校验的添加方式,从预设配置的第一数据库中确定传输块循环冗余校验的添加方式之后,所述方法还包括:发送半静态配置信息给所述接收设备以使所述接收设备从预先配置的第二数据库中确定传输块循环冗余校验的添加方式;或通过发送动态信令或者控制信息的方式给所述接收设备以使所述接收设备从预先配置的第二数据库中确定传输块循环冗余校验的添加方式,所述第二数据库包含至少一种传输块循环冗余校验的添加方式。根据本专利技术优选实施例,所确定的传输块循环冗余校验的添加方式包括:在传输块的一端添加传输块循环冗余校验;或在传输块的两端添加传输块循环冗余校验。根据本专利技术优选实施例,所述根据所确定的传输块循环冗余校验的添加方式确定传输块循环冗余校验的长度包括:当传输块的长度小于或者等于第一预设值,且所确定的传输块循环冗余校验的添加方式为在传输块的一端添加传输块循环冗余校验时,确定所述传输块循环冗余校验的长度为第一预设长度;当传输块的长度大于所述第一预设值,且所确定的传输块循环冗余校验的添加方式为在传输块的一端添加传输块循环冗余校验时,确定所述传输块循环冗余校验的长度为第二预设长度,所述第二预设长度大于所述第一预设长度;或当传输块的长度大于所述第一预设值,且所确定的传输块循环冗余校验的添加方式为在传输块的两端添加传输块循环冗余校验时,确定在传输块的两端分别添加第一传输块循环冗余校验及第二传输块循环冗余校验,且所述第一传输块循环冗余校验的长度与所述第二传输块循环冗余校验的长度之和大于所述第一预设长度。根据本专利技术优选实施例,基于所述第一传输块循环冗余校验的长度计算第一传输块循环冗余校验比特的计算方式及基于所述第二传输块循环冗余校验的长度计算第二传输块循环冗余校验比特的计算方式包括以下一种或者多种:从传输块的第一个比特开始按顺序计算所述第一传输块循环冗余校验比特或所述第二传输块循环冗余校验比特;从传输块的最后一个比特开始按逆序计算所述第一传输块循环冗余校验比特或所述第二传输块循环冗余校验比特。根据本专利技术优选实施例,所述传输块循环冗余校验的添加方式用于上行数据的传输块及/或下行数据的传输块。一种数据传输方法,应用于接收设备,所述方法包括:接收发送设备发送的数据;确定传输块TB循环冗余校验CRC的添加方式;根据所确定的传输块循环冗余校验的添加方式确定传输块循环冗余校验的长度;基于所述传输块循环冗余校验的长度,对所述数据中的传输块循环冗余校验比特进行校验;当所述传输块循环冗余校验比特校验正确时,获取所述数据中的传输块。根据本专利技术优选实施例,所述确定传输块循环冗余校验的添加方式包括以下一种或者多种:通过静态的方式获取预先定义的传输块循环冗余校验的添加方式;或接收所述发送设备发送的半静态配置信息,并根据所述半静态配置信息从预先配置的第二数据库中确定传输块循环冗余校验的添加方式;或接收所述发送设备发送的动态信令或者控制信息的方式,并根据动态信令或者控制信息的方从预先配置的第二数据库中确定传输块循环冗余校验的添加方式,所述第二数据库包含至少一种传输块循环冗余校验的添加方式。根据本专利技术优选实施例,在接收发送设备发送的数据之前,所述方法还包括:通过信令将所选择的传输块循环冗余校验的添加方式通知给所述发送设备以供所述发送设备确定传输块循环冗余校验的添加方式,所述信令本文档来自技高网
...
数据传输方法及装置

【技术保护点】
一种数据传输方法,应用于发送设备,其特征在于,所述方法包括:确定传输块循环冗余校验的添加方式;根据所确定的传输块循环冗余校验的添加方式确定传输块循环冗余校验的长度;基于所述传输块循环冗余校验的长度,计算传输块循环冗余校验比特,并将所述传输块循环冗余校验比特作为传输块的一部分;对包含所述传输块循环冗余校验比特的传输块进行处理,并将处理后的数据发送给接收设备。

【技术特征摘要】
1.一种数据传输方法,应用于发送设备,其特征在于,所述方法包括:确定传输块循环冗余校验的添加方式;根据所确定的传输块循环冗余校验的添加方式确定传输块循环冗余校验的长度;基于所述传输块循环冗余校验的长度,计算传输块循环冗余校验比特,并将所述传输块循环冗余校验比特作为传输块的一部分;对包含所述传输块循环冗余校验比特的传输块进行处理,并将处理后的数据发送给接收设备。2.如权利要求1所述的数据传输方法,其特征在于,所述确定传输块循环冗余校验的添加方式包括:通过静态的方式,获取预先定义的传输块循环冗余校验的添加方式;或根据通信调度策略从预设配置的第一数据库中确定传输块的循环冗余校验的添加方式;或接收所述接收设备发送的所选择的传输块循环冗余校验的添加方式,并根据所述接收设备所选择的传输块循环冗余校验的添加方式,从预先配置的第一数据库中确定传输块循环冗余校验的添加方式,所述第一数据库包含至少一种传输块循环冗余校验的添加方式。3.如权利要求2所述的数据传输方法,其特征在于,在根据通信调度策略从预设配置的第一数据库中确定传输块的循环冗余校验的添加方式之后,或在根据所述接收设备所选择的传输块循环冗余校验的添加方式,从预设配置的第一数据库中确定传输块循环冗余校验的添加方式之后,所述方法还包括:发送半静态配置信息给所述接收设备以使所述接收设备从预先配置的第二数据库中确定传输块循环冗余校验的添加方式;或通过发送动态信令或者控制信息给所述接收设备以使所述接收设备从预先配置的第二数据库中确定传输块循环冗余校验的添加方式,所述第二数据库包含至少一种传输块循环冗余校验的添加方式。4.如权利要求1所述的数据传输方法,其特征在于,所确定的传输块循环冗余校验的添加方式包括:在传输块的一端添加传输块循环冗余校验;或在传输块的两端添加传输块循环冗余校验。5.如权利要求4所述的数据传输方法,其特征在于,所述根据所确定的传输块循环冗余校验的添加方式确定传输块循环冗余校验的长度包括:当传输块的长度小于或者等于第一预设值,且所确定的传输块循环冗余校验的添加方式为在传输块的一端添加传输块循环冗余校验时,确定所述传输块循环冗余校验的长度为第一预设长度;当传输块的长度大于所述第一预设值,且所确定的传输块循环冗余校验的添加方式为在传输块的一端添加传输块循环冗余校验时,确定所述传输块循环冗余校验的长度为第二预设长度,所述第二预设长度大于所述第一预设长度;或当传输块的长度大于所述第一预设值,且所确定的传输块循环冗余校验的添加方式为在传输块的两端添加传输块循环冗余校验时,确定在传输块的两端分别添加第一传输块循环冗余校验及第二传输块循环冗余校验,且所述第一传输块循环冗余校验的长度与所述第二传输块循环冗余校验的长度之和大于所述第一预设长度。6.如权利要求5中所述的数据传输方法,在其特征在于,基于所述第一传输块循环冗余校验的长度计算第一传输块循环冗余校验比特的计算方式及基于所述第二传输块循环冗余校验的长度计算第二传输块循环冗余校验比特的计算方式包括以下一种或者多种:从传输块的第一个比特开始按顺序计算所述第一传输块循环冗余校验比特或所述第二传输块循环冗余校验比特;从传输块的最后一个比特开始按逆序计算所述第一传输块循环冗余校验比特或所述第二传输块循环冗余校验比特。7.一种数据传输方法,应用于接收设备,其特征在于,所述方法包括:接收发送设备发送的数据;确定传输块循环冗余校验的添加方式;根据所确定的传输块循环冗余校验的添加方式确定传输块循环冗余校验的长度;基于所述传输块循环冗余校验的长度,对所述数据中的传输块循环冗余校验比特进行校验;当所述传输块循环冗余校验比特校验正确时,获取所述数据中的传输块。8.如权利要求7所述的数据传输方法,其特征在于,所述确定传输块循环冗余校验的添加方式包括以下一种或者多种:通过静态的方式获取预先定义的传输块循环冗余校验的添加方式;或接收所述发送设备发送的半静态配置信息,并根据所述半静态配置信息从预先配置的第二数据库中确定传输块循环冗余校验的添加方式;或接收所述发送设备发送的动态信令或者控制信息的方式,并根据动态信令或者控制信息的方从预先配置的第二数据库中确定传输块循环冗余校验的添加方式,所述第二数据库包含至少一种传输块循环冗余校验的添加方式。9.如权利要求7所述的数据传输方法,在其特征在于,在接收发送设备发送的数据之前,所述方法还包括:通过信令将所选择的传输块循环冗余校验的添加方式通知给所述发送设备以供所述发送设备确定传输块循环冗余校验的添加方式,所述信令的下发方式包括以下一种或者多种:动态下发、半静态配置信令下发。10.一种数据传输装置,运行于发送设备,其特征在于,所述装置包括:确定模块,用于确定传输块循环冗余校验的添加方式;所述...

【专利技术属性】
技术研发人员:张伟李明菊张云飞
申请(专利权)人:宇龙计算机通信科技深圳有限公司
类型:发明
国别省市:广东,44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1